125 SF- Luke Lilledahl vs. Sulayman Bah (COL)

Period 1:
Here we go. Tying up & hand fighting to start. Luke reaches for a leg, but Bah blocks him off. Bah reaches for an ankle, but can't get there. Luke shoots, but Bah blocks him off. Stalemate & restart. Hand fighting & circlign. Luke reaches for a low leg, but can't get there. Bah reaches, but no luck. Luke drops in on a leg, elevates it & trips Bah to the mat for the TD on the edge, 3-0. Luke has Bah bellied out. Bah works to his base & they go out of bounds, restart. Bah is still down. Bah works to his feet, but Luke brings him back to the mat & has him bellied out now. Luke goes over 1-min of riding time. Luke has a leg-figure-foured. Bah gets a stall warning & the period expires. 3-0 Luke, +1:21 RT

Period 2:
Luke takes down. He works to his feet & gets the escape, 4-0. Luke snatches an ankle & elevates the leg. He's trying to trip Bah to the mat, but Bah is long. Luke keeps working & finishes the TD on the edge, 7-0. Out of bounds & restart. Bah is still down. He works to his feet & gets the escape, 7-1. Circling & hand fighting with some head tapping. Bah shoots, but can't get there. Luke presses forward. He reaches for a leg, but no luck. Luke snaps & comes behind for another TD, 10-1, just before the period ends. 10-1 Luke, +1:28 RT

Period 3:
Bah takes neutral. Circling, hand fighting & collar ties. Luke snaps & looks for an opening, but can't finish. Bah with some fakes. Luke reaches for an ankle, then switches to a leg & adds another TD, 13-1. That was slick. Luke cuts Bah, 13-2. Hand fighting & tying up. Bah shoots & gets a leg. Luke locks through the crotch. Out of bounds & restart, 30-sec left. Luke shoots, but can't get there. Luke shoots at the end & adds another TD for the 18-2 tech. I missed a TD somewhere.

Luke Lilledahl TECH Sulayman Bah 18-2 (7:00)

133 SF- Marcus Blaze vs. Jake Crapps (Army)

Period 1:
Blaze is up 3-0, 1:13 left in the 1st. He just went over 1-min riding time & is hammering on top. Blaze is looking to lock up a cradle, but loses the grip. Blaze goes over 2-min riding time. He has an arm barred & the period ends. 3-0 Blaze, +2:11 RT

Period 2:
Blaze takes down. He works to his feet & gets the escape, 4-0. Crapps shoots & gets in deep on a leg. Blaze sprawls back & they go out of bounds, restart. Blaze presses forward. Crapps reaches for an ankle, but can't get there. Blaze keeps coming forward. Crapps shoots. Blaze counters & comes behind for the TD, 7-0. Blaze locks up a cradle & rolls Crapps over, but slips & loses the grip. Blaze cuts Crapps, 7-1. Circling, tying up & hand fighting. Blaze hits a slick duck, 10-1 & is looking for back points, but time expires. 10-1 Blaze, +2:26 RT

Period 3:
Crapps takes neutral. Blaze presses forward. Crapps pushes back. Blaze reaches for a leg, but can't get there & the feed cuts out. More technical difficulties. Back to action. Same score. Blaze gets a leg, then the ankle & finishes the TD, 13-1. Blaze cuts Crapps, 13-2. Crapps drives forward & gets a TD, 13-5. Blaze gets the escape, 14-5. Blaze shoots, but can't get there. He keeps working & gets a leg, then finishes the TD, just before the period ends, 17-5. Blaze adds a shot clock point, 18-5.

Marcus Blaze MD Jake Crapps 18-5

The all-Penn State semifinal at heavyweight is over​

Cole Mirasola used a double leg takedown to break a 1-1 tie and beat teammate Lucas Cochran in one 285-pound semifinal. He's off to the finals.
